The Structure and Role of Trump's Justice Department

Trump's Justice Department, led by Attorney General Jeff Sessions and later by William Barr, played a pivotal role in shaping the legal agenda of the Trump administration. The department's responsibilities included enforcing federal laws, prosecuting federal crimes, and providing legal advice to the executive branch. However, the department's actions under Trump were often scrutinized for their political motivations and potential biases.

One of the most notable aspects of Trump's Justice Department was its approach to immigration enforcement. The department implemented a series of policies aimed at tightening border controls and increasing deportations. These policies included the "zero-tolerance" policy, which led to the separation of families at the border, and the expansion of detention facilities for undocumented immigrants. These actions sparked widespread criticism and legal challenges, highlighting the department's role in shaping the nation's immigration policies.

High-Profile Cases and Controversies

Trump's Justice Department was involved in several high-profile cases and controversies that garnered significant media attention and public scrutiny. One of the most contentious issues was the department's handling of the Mueller investigation into Russian interference in the 2016 presidential election. The investigation, led by Special Counsel Robert Mueller, resulted in a comprehensive report that detailed numerous instances of potential obstruction of justice by Trump and his associates. However, the department's decision not to pursue charges against Trump sparked widespread debate and criticism.

The Impact on Federal Law Enforcement

Trump's Justice Department also had a significant impact on federal law enforcement agencies, including the FBI and the Department of Homeland Security. The administration's focus on immigration enforcement led to increased funding and resources for border patrol and immigration enforcement agencies. However, this focus also resulted in a shift in priorities away from other areas of law enforcement, such as cybersecurity and counterterrorism.

The department's approach to law enforcement also raised concerns about political interference and bias. Critics argued that the department's actions were often driven by political motivations rather than a commitment to impartial justice. For example, the department's decision to drop charges against former National Security Advisor Michael Flynn, who had pleaded guilty to lying to the FBI, was seen by many as a politically motivated move to protect Trump and his associates.

Trump's Justice Department faced numerous legal challenges and court battles during its tenure. One of the most significant legal battles involved the department's attempt to add a citizenship question to the 2020 census. The department argued that the question was necessary to enforce the Voting Rights Act, but critics contended that it was a politically motivated effort to suppress the votes of minority communities. The Supreme Court ultimately blocked the addition of the citizenship question, dealing a significant blow to the department's plans.

Another major legal battle involved the department's efforts to challenge state-level policies on immigration and sanctuary cities. The department sued several states and cities over their refusal to cooperate with federal immigration enforcement efforts, arguing that these policies undermined federal law. However, many of these lawsuits were ultimately dismissed or settled, highlighting the challenges faced by the department in enforcing its policies.
